London's modern-city-pop band Prep visited Manila for the fifth time, bringing new tracks and never-been-played hits for Filipino fans at the Filinvest Tent Alabang.Since 2015, the artists have released a couple of popular songs such as 'Cheapest Flight,' 'Who's Got You Singing Again,' 'Line by Line,' 'Futures,' and their rendition of Harry Styles' 'As It Was.
Nevertheless, they shared, 'It was just about finding a way of tuning into the energy of the song in the right way.'Asking each member an enjoyable track to perform live, Dan Radclyffe picked their latest song, 'Call It ,' as he finds the new harmonies and solos amusing.
